    ACPI / OSL: Make acpi_os_map_cleanup() use call_rcu() to avoid deadlocks
    
    Deadlock is possible when CPU hotplug and evaluating ACPI method happen
    at the same time.
    
    During CPU hotplug, acpi_cpu_soft_notify() is called under the CPU hotplug
    lock.  Then, acpi_cpu_soft_notify() calls acpi_bus_get_device() to obtain
    the struct acpi_device attached to the given ACPI handle.  The ACPICA's
    namespace lock will be acquired by acpi_bus_get_device() in the process.
    Thus it is possible to hold the ACPICA's namespace lock under the CPU
    hotplug lock.
    
    Evaluating an ACPI method may involve accessing an operation region in
    system memory and the associated address space will be unmapped under
    the ACPICA's namespace lock after completing the access. Currently, osl.c
    uses RCU to protect memory ranges used by AML.  When unmapping them it
    calls synchronize_rcu() in acpi_os_map_cleanup(), but that blocks
    CPU hotplug by acquiring the CPU hotplug lock.  Thus it is possible to
    hold the CPU hotplug lock under the ACPICA's namespace lock.
    
    This leads to deadlocks like the following one if AML accessing operation
    regions in memory is executed in parallel with CPU hotplug.

    To avoid such deadlocks, modify acpi_os_map_cleanup() to use call_rcu()
    for the unmapping of memory regions that aren't used any more.
